Categories:
Audio (13)
Biotech (29)
Bytecode (36)
Database (77)
Framework (7)
Game (7)
General (507)
Graphics (53)
I/O (35)
IDE (2)
JAR Tools (102)
JavaBeans (21)
JDBC (121)
JDK (426)
JSP (20)
Logging (108)
Mail (58)
Messaging (8)
Network (84)
PDF (97)
Report (7)
Scripting (84)
Security (32)
Server (121)
Servlet (26)
SOAP (24)
Testing (54)
Web (15)
XML (322)
Collections:
Other Resources:
JDK 17 jdk.compiler.jmod - Compiler Tool
JDK 17 jdk.compiler.jmod is the JMOD file for JDK 17 Compiler tool,
which can be invoked by the "javac" command.
JDK 17 Compiler tool compiled class files are stored in \fyicenter\jdk-17.0.5\jmods\jdk.compiler.jmod.
JDK 17 Compiler tool compiled class files are also linked and stored in the \fyicenter\jdk-17.0.5\lib\modules JImage file.
JDK 17 Compiler source code files are stored in \fyicenter\jdk-17.0.5\lib\src.zip\jdk.compiler.
You can click and view the content of each source code file in the list below.
✍: FYIcenter
⏎ com/sun/source/doctree/DocCommentTree.java
/*
* Copyright (c) 2011, 2020, Oracle and/or its affiliates. All rights reserved.
* ORACLE PROPRIETARY/CONFIDENTIAL. Use is subject to license terms.
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*
*/
package com.sun.source.doctree;
import java.util.ArrayList;
import java.util.Collections;
import java.util.List;
/**
* The top-level representation of a documentation comment.
*
* <pre>
* first-sentence body block-tags
* </pre>
*
* @since 1.8
*/
public interface DocCommentTree extends DocTree {
/**
* Returns the first sentence of a documentation comment.
* @return the first sentence of a documentation comment
*/
List<? extends DocTree> getFirstSentence();
/**
* Returns the entire body of a documentation comment, appearing
* before any block tags, including the first sentence.
* @return body of a documentation comment first sentence inclusive
*
* @since 9
*/
default List<? extends DocTree> getFullBody() {
ArrayList<DocTree> bodyList = new ArrayList<>();
bodyList.addAll(getFirstSentence());
bodyList.addAll(getBody());
return bodyList;
}
/**
* Returns the body of a documentation comment,
* appearing after the first sentence, and before any block tags.
* @return the body of a documentation comment
*/
List<? extends DocTree> getBody();
/**
* Returns the block tags for a documentation comment.
* @return the block tags of a documentation comment
*/
List<? extends DocTree> getBlockTags();
/**
* Returns a list of trees containing the content (if any) preceding
* the content of the documentation comment.
* When the {@code DocCommentTree} has been read from a documentation
* comment in a Java source file, the list will be empty.
* When the {@code DocCommentTree} has been read from an HTML file, this
* represents the content from the beginning of the file up to and
* including the {@code <body>} tag.
*
* @implSpec This implementation returns an empty list.
*
* @return the list of trees
* @since 10
*/
default List<? extends DocTree> getPreamble() {
return Collections.emptyList();
}
/**
* Returns a list of trees containing the content (if any) following the
* content of the documentation comment.
* When the {@code DocCommentTree} has been read from a documentation
* comment in a Java source file, the list will be empty.
* When {@code DocCommentTree} has been read from an HTML file, this
* represents the content from the {@code </body>} tag to the end of file.
*
* @implSpec This implementation returns an empty list.
*
* @return the list of trees
* @since 10
*/
default List<? extends DocTree> getPostamble() {
return Collections.emptyList();
}
}
⏎ com/sun/source/doctree/DocCommentTree.java
Or download all of them as a single archive file:
File name: jdk.compiler-17.0.5-src.zip File size: 1450209 bytes Release date: 2022-09-13 Download
⇒ JDK 17 jdk.crypto.cryptoki.jmod - Crypto KI Module
2023-10-15, ≈75🔥, 0💬
Popular Posts:
What Is poi-scratchpad-5.2.3.jar ?poi-scratchpad-5.2.3.jar is one of the JAR files for Apache POI 5....
JRE 8 rt.jar is the JAR file for JRE 8 RT (Runtime) libraries. JRE (Java Runtime) 8 is the runtime e...
JDK 7 tools.jar is the JAR file for JDK 7 tools. It contains Java classes to support different JDK t...
What Is poi-scratchpad-3.5.jar? poi-scratchpad-3.5.jar is one of the JAR files for Apache POI 3.5, w...
What Is wstx-asl-3.2.8.jar? wstx-asl-3.2.8.jar is JAR file for the ASL component of Woodstox 3.2.8. ...